Recognizing Protection Techniques
Recognizing the various protection methods your attorney might use is essential to properly browsing your instance. Each strategy rests on the specifics of the costs you're dealing with and the proof versus you. Let's look into what you require to recognize.
First off, if there's an absence of evidence, your attorney may suggest that the prosecution hasn't met its burden of proof. Keep in mind, it's not your work to confirm virtue; it's the district attorney's job to confirm regret past a sensible question. If they can't, you must be acquitted.
An additional typical approach is self-defense, specifically in cases entailing fees like attack or murder. If you were securing on your own, your lawyer may utilize this method to warrant your actions lawfully. This requires verifying that your understanding of threat was reasonable which your feedback was proportionate to that hazard.
Occasionally, your defense could entail doubting the legitimacy of exactly how proof was acquired. If law enforcement broke your civil liberties during the examination, evidence could be reduced, which can significantly weaken the prosecution's situation.
Lastly, your lawyer may discuss an appeal offer if it offers your benefit. This normally happens if the evidence against you is strong however there are mitigating factors that can bring about reduced charges or sentencing.
Recognizing these approaches aids you review your situation better with your attorney.
